"Leftmove Estate Agents are delighted to offer for sale this beautifully presented extended three bedroom dormer bungalow situated in the popular village of Freckleton. The property briefly comprises of entrance porch and hallway, lounge, open plan kitchen diner and sun lounge, master bedroom with ensuite and dressing room, second bedroom with ensuite, third bedroom and family bathroom. The property benefits from UPVC double glazing and gas central heating throughout. The property has recently been renovated to a high standard throughout, and boasts well maintained gardens to front and rear, large driveway providing off road parking for several vehicles and single garage with up and over door, power and light. Ideally located for all local amenities, schools and transport links, this property simply must be viewed to fully appreciate the accommodation and lifestyle on offer.
